Aircraft Description

N623JL is a 1997 Gulfstream Aerospace G-IV, a twin-engine turbo-fan aircraft registered to Jomar Aviation LLC in Boca Raton, FL. This aircraft holds a standard airworthiness certificate issued by the Federal Aviation Administration on May 1, 2019. The registration certificate was issued on August 20, 2020. Gulfstream Aerospace, a subsidiary of General Dynamics based in Savannah, Georgia, manufactures some of the world's most advanced business jets. From the G280 to the flagship G700, Gulfstream aircraft are known for their range, speed, and cabin luxury.
